The Faculty of Community and Health Sciences at the University of the Western Cape is situated on two campuses namely; Main campus and Bellville campus. The Faculty is one of the leading institutions for the education of health sciences professionals in South Africa. The Faculty offers professional qualifications in Dietetics, Occupational Therapy, Nursing, Physiotherapy, Psychology, Social Work, Community Development, Inter-Professional Education, Centre for Interdisciplinary Studies of Children Families and Society (CISCFS), Complementary Medicine, Public Health and Biokinetics.
